Output ead66ca327b6a204335e23d3bdfa2f529f59fd2682ea0119282827746339c936:129

value
54960
script pubkey
OP_0 OP_PUSHBYTES_32 81d6387252563d3824994fc1c9389f2730d670b3f98b0ec77d6090a020e4aeb6
address
bc1qs8trsujj2c7nsfyeflqujwylyucdvu9nlx9sa3mavzg2qg8y46mqmqvg26
transaction
ead66ca327b6a204335e23d3bdfa2f529f59fd2682ea0119282827746339c936
confirmations
61716
spent
true